The director and producer Brendan Walter used the Pocket Cinema Camera 6K with the códec Blackmagic RAW y DaVinci Resolve in grading the video clip.

Same Sun

The new video clip of Jasmine Ash, Same Sun, has been filmed by Brendan Walter with the model Pocket Cinema Camera 6K of Blackmagic Design. Likewise, he used the códec Blackmagic RAW y DaVinci Resolve for grading, which gave him the opportunity to capture an entire neighborhood with people in their homes, recording them with natural light through the windows.

Same Sun is the latest song by popular singer-songwriter Jasmine Ash, who is also the lead vocalist of the band Oh Darling and singer of the hit Starlight. The video clip shows the artist alongside Walter, who directed the filming, driving through Los Angeles greeting people on the street. It is, in essence, a love letter to the city in which the two protagonists appear interacting with strangers, friends and family from the windows, rooftops or behind the fences of their homes.

Same SunThe original plan was completely different, but due to the quarantine they were forced to change the idea, and Walter had to find a way to ensure that the recorded material was of high quality in lighting situations that he could not control. In order to carry it out, he chose the Pocket Cinema Camera 6K model for its high dynamic range, its performance in low light conditions and its compact size. These features gave you the ability to go anywhere without needing a computer.

"When we had to cancel the original plan, we ran into obstacles everywhere. No equipment, no studio, and of course no thought of inviting anyone. So we had to do it with what we had at home and in the neighborhood. We had two options: wait or try. Fortunately, I had already used the Pocket Cinema Camera 6K and knew that it would give me a great ability to be creative," says Walter.

To get started, they both used an app called NextDoor, which is like a social network for the community, with the goal of asking as many people in the surrounding area as possible if they wanted to participate. Jasmine would always maintain a safe distance, but at the same time create a connection between people. Then, using the Pocket Cinema Camera 6K model filming in Blackmagic RAW, Walter would follow her from house to house capturing the encounters.

Same SunFor the video clip, they wanted to get great documentary style cinematic quality, at the same time they wanted the feeling to be that of a homemade project. One of the big challenges was the lighting, since they couldn't control it, and the changes in it when recording from the outside in through the windows.

"One of the shots that we had to repeat several times was the panoramic shots of the houses using the zoom because usually the changes in lighting are very dramatic and many cameras have problems with their processing. Especially one in particular in which we filmed a sunny view of the entire house and a couple dancing in their living room in very low light. Of course we couldn't ask them to install better lamps, but I knew that with the Blackmagic RAW codec and the Pocket I would achieve exactly what I needed," adds Brendan Walter.

"The camera's performance in low light and natural lighting is exceptional. With its high dynamic range and the images with natural colors and skin tones obtained when using Blackmagic RAW, I was confident that loading the footage recorded in DaVinci Resolve would achieve my goal," he concludes.
